[Others] Qt6开发的新版qbittorrent打不开
Tofloor
poster avatar
lizipeng0013
deepin
2022-06-18 02:57
Author

我下载的appimage软件包,无法打开软件,看终端的信息好象是deepin系统缺少了软件必须的组件

录屏_deepin-terminal_20220617185450.gif

终端信息如下:

lizipeng@lizipeng-PC:~/Downloads$ ./qbittorrent-4.4.3.1_x86_64.AppImage 
/tmp/.mount_qbittozfJbqf/AppRun.wrapped: /lib/x86_64-linux-gnu/libm.so.6: version `GLIBC_2.29' not found (required by /tmp/.mount_qbittozfJbqf/AppRun.wrapped)
/tmp/.mount_qbittozfJbqf/AppRun.wrapped: /lib/x86_64-linux-gnu/libm.so.6: version `GLIBC_2.29' not found (required by /tmp/.mount_qbittozfJbqf/usr/bin/../lib/libQt6Widgets.so.6)
/tmp/.mount_qbittozfJbqf/AppRun.wrapped: /lib/x86_64-linux-gnu/libstdc++.so.6: version `GLIBCXX_3.4.26' not found (required by /tmp/.mount_qbittozfJbqf/usr/bin/../lib/libQt6Widgets.so.6)
/tmp/.mount_qbittozfJbqf/AppRun.wrapped: /lib/x86_64-linux-gnu/libstdc++.so.6: version `GLIBCXX_3.4.28' not found (required by /tmp/.mount_qbittozfJbqf/usr/bin/../lib/libQt6Widgets.so.6)
/tmp/.mount_qbittozfJbqf/AppRun.wrapped: /lib/x86_64-linux-gnu/libm.so.6: version `GLIBC_2.29' not found (required by /tmp/.mount_qbittozfJbqf/usr/bin/../lib/libQt6Gui.so.6)
/tmp/.mount_qbittozfJbqf/AppRun.wrapped: /lib/x86_64-linux-gnu/libstdc++.so.6: version `GLIBCXX_3.4.26' not found (required by /tmp/.mount_qbittozfJbqf/usr/bin/../lib/libQt6Gui.so.6)
/tmp/.mount_qbittozfJbqf/AppRun.wrapped: /lib/x86_64-linux-gnu/libstdc++.so.6: version `GLIBCXX_3.4.28' not found (required by /tmp/.mount_qbittozfJbqf/usr/bin/../lib/libQt6Gui.so.6)
/tmp/.mount_qbittozfJbqf/AppRun.wrapped: /lib/x86_64-linux-gnu/libstdc++.so.6: version `GLIBCXX_3.4.28' not found (required by /tmp/.mount_qbittozfJbqf/usr/bin/../lib/libQt6Xml.so.6)
/tmp/.mount_qbittozfJbqf/AppRun.wrapped: /lib/x86_64-linux-gnu/libstdc++.so.6: version `GLIBCXX_3.4.26' not found (required by /tmp/.mount_qbittozfJbqf/usr/bin/../lib/libQt6Xml.so.6)
/tmp/.mount_qbittozfJbqf/AppRun.wrapped: /lib/x86_64-linux-gnu/libm.so.6: version `GLIBC_2.29' not found (required by /tmp/.mount_qbittozfJbqf/usr/bin/../lib/libQt6Core.so.6)
/tmp/.mount_qbittozfJbqf/AppRun.wrapped: /lib/x86_64-linux-gnu/libstdc++.so.6: version `GLIBCXX_3.4.26' not found (required by /tmp/.mount_qbittozfJbqf/usr/bin/../lib/libQt6Core.so.6)
/tmp/.mount_qbittozfJbqf/AppRun.wrapped: /lib/x86_64-linux-gnu/libstdc++.so.6: version `GLIBCXX_3.4.28' not found (required by /tmp/.mount_qbittozfJbqf/usr/bin/../lib/libQt6Core.so.6)
/tmp/.mount_qbittozfJbqf/AppRun.wrapped: /lib/x86_64-linux-gnu/libm.so.6: version `GLIBC_2.29' not found (required by /tmp/.mount_qbittozfJbqf/usr/bin/../lib/libpng16.so.16)
/tmp/.mount_qbittozfJbqf/AppRun.wrapped: /lib/x86_64-linux-gnu/libm.so.6: version `GLIBC_2.29' not found (required by /tmp/.mount_qbittozfJbqf/usr/bin/../lib/libicui18n.so.66)
/tmp/.mount_qbittozfJbqf/AppRun.wrapped: /lib/x86_64-linux-gnu/libm.so.6: version `GLIBC_2.29' not found (required by /tmp/.mount_qbittozfJbqf/usr/bin/../lib/libicuuc.so.66)
/tmp/.mount_qbittozfJbqf/AppRun.wrapped: /lib/x86_64-linux-gnu/libc.so.6: version `GLIBC_2.30' not found (required by /tmp/.mount_qbittozfJbqf/usr/bin/../lib/libsystemd.so.0)
lizipeng@lizipeng-PC:~/Downloads$ 

Reply Favorite View the author
All Replies
sukanka
deepin
2022-06-18 03:05
#1

glibc版本不对,这个你应该用不上了。

Reply View the author
lizipeng0013
deepin
2022-06-18 03:16
#2

还有另一个软件eka2l1,也是appimage包,同样打不开

lizipeng@lizipeng-PC:~/Downloads/Compressed/ubuntu-latest$ ./eka2l1-qt-x64.AppImage 
/tmp/.mount_eka2l1gNp5d7/AppRun.wrapped: /lib/x86_64-linux-gnu/libm.so.6: version `GLIBC_2.29' not found (required by /tmp/.mount_eka2l1gNp5d7/AppRun.wrapped)
/tmp/.mount_eka2l1gNp5d7/AppRun.wrapped: /lib/x86_64-linux-gnu/libstdc++.so.6: version `GLIBCXX_3.4.26' not found (required by /tmp/.mount_eka2l1gNp5d7/AppRun.wrapped)
lizipeng@lizipeng-PC:~/Downloads/Compressed/ubuntu-latest$ 

Reply View the author
lizipeng0013
deepin
2022-06-18 03:18
#3
sukanka

glibc版本不对,这个你应该用不上了。

用不上是什么意思?

Reply View the author
GBwater
deepin
2022-06-18 03:27
#4
lizipeng0013

用不上是什么意思?

没qt6的库怎么用qt6的软件?

Reply View the author
deepin-superuser
deepin
2022-06-18 03:47
#5
GBwater

没qt6的库怎么用qt6的软件?

自己编译qt6

Reply View the author
安洛
deepin
2022-06-18 06:12
#6

glibc版本低了。然而glibc是系统底层组件,不建议自己更新。个人建议等系统更新或使用旧一点版本的软件。

Reply View the author
flwwater
deepin
2022-06-18 14:58
#7

$ ldd --version
ldd (Ubuntu GLIBC 2.35-0ubuntu3) 2.35

这是我的机器,用 ldd --version 命令就能查看你的GLIBC版本

Reply View the author
lizipeng0013
deepin
2022-06-19 00:48
#8
flwwater

$ ldd --version
ldd (Ubuntu GLIBC 2.35-0ubuntu3) 2.35

这是我的机器,用 ldd --version 命令就能查看你的GLIBC版本

看样子真用不上了,deepin的版本确实有点老了

lizipeng@lizipeng-PC:~/Desktop$ ldd --version
ldd (Debian GLIBC 2.28.19-1+dde) 2.28
Copyright (C) 2018 自由软件基金会。
这是一个自由软件;请见源代码的授权条款。本软件不含任何没有担保;甚至不保证适销性
或者适合某些特殊目的。
由 Roland McGrath 和 Ulrich Drepper 编写。

Reply View the author
Alan-lu
deepin
2022-06-21 18:48
#9

deepin已经适配Qt6 预计下个版本发布

Reply View the author